We had originally done a Series B, oh, gosh, when was it?
I guess it was back in mid-2015, I want to say.
And at the time, we were fortunate enough to have multiple term sheets.
And we ended up taking a Series B with a great partner.
Our partners today include Sequoia and Mayfield and Battery.
And we were fortunate enough to have multiple term sheets.
So at the time, one of the investors came and said, hey, can we add a little bit more money?
And at the time, we didn't really need more money.
I didn't really want the dilution.
The sun was shining in the VC environment.
And then towards the
the end of 2015, you know, people started downgrading the value of Snapchat and all these other unicorns, and people were thinking that winter was, you know, rain clouds were forming, and people were thinking that winter is coming again in the VC environment.
And
Turns out later that after a year, it looks like the rain clouds had disappeared by the time we didn't know.
So we had an opportunity to bulk up the balance sheet by another $5 million.
And when I saw rain clouds forming, I said, hey, maybe it makes sense to get a winter coat from a capital perspective, just to have a healthier balance sheet.
It was a very pragmatic move.
